The Chicago Park District and Lincoln Park Zoo announce the return of Family Nature Days, an interactive, nature-based program for the entire family. Lincoln Park Zoo will host the nature play series at Chicago parks across the city, through November 2. Park locations include Kilbourn Park and Welles Park. All of the pop-up nature play dates are admission free. During Family Nature Days, children and adults are invited to engage in free play like fort building with natural items, including stumps and seeds, brush up on bird-watching or nature hiking skills, and/or venture out on family scavenger hunts. The schedule for the program is as follows: 

Saturday, October 19 | 10 a.m.-12 p.m.
Kilbourn Park, 3501 North Kilbourn Ave.

Saturday, November 2 | 10 a.m.- 12 p.m.
Welles Park, 2333 West Sunnyside Ave.
